Sahih Muslim
كتاب الجمعة
The Book of Prayer - Friday
" بِئْسَ الْخَطِيبُ أَنْتَ . قُلْ وَمَنْ يَعْصِ اللَّهَ وَرَسُولَهُ "
that a person recited a sermon before the Messenger of Allah (ﷺ) thus: He who obeys Allah and His Apostle, he in fact follows the right path, and he who disobeys both of them, he goes astray. Upon this the Messenger of Allah (ﷺ) said: What a bad speaker you are; say: He who disobeys Allah and His Apostle. Ibn Numair added: He in fact went astray.
